Ahh, fuck, my interior maps look like piss compared to everyone else's.

A little help? (Not good with large interiors.)
This is supposed to be some kind of conference room with a small storage compartment.

It looks a bit empty, like the room is too large or something. What I would do is try making the table larger, put more filler stuff in, try to squeeze in another room, or just make the map a tile or two smaller. Try all of those and pick whatever looks best ;D

Also, adding windows somehow just makes every interior map I see look a lot better. Yo!
That would take up a bit more room, but really, larger maps do not always equal good. If you have trouble filling up a map, reduce the size a bit. It's surprising how much difference a point or two less can make.

It's not bad.
A few things, though:
The top house looks too narrow. Have you tried it with a height of 3 roof tiles?
The windows of the houses are oddly placed.
The pavement looks weird. There need to be more objects placed on the pavement or something, because as it is it just jumps out and clashes with everything else.
The back of the houses look strange. I don't know what it is, but the immediate use of trees and tall grass behind a house looks bad to me.
I also suggest that you either move the third house on the bottom up to align with the other two, or make the pavement 2 tiles deep instead of 1, just to see how it looks.
